Overview of the Course

The AP Language and Composition course is designed to help students become skilled readers and writers, with a focus on analyzing and interpreting complex texts, including nonfiction works, such as essays and speeches, as well as fiction, like novels and short stories․ The course aims to prepare students for college-level writing and reading, with an emphasis on critical thinking, close reading, and effective communication․ Through a variety of

    assignments and activities

, students will learn to identify and analyze rhetorical devices, understand different writing styles, and develop their own unique voice and perspective․ By the end of the course, students will be able to read and understand complex texts, write clear and effective essays, and demonstrate a deep understanding of the subject matter, including the ability to

    identify and explain literary devices

and analyze the author’s purpose and tone․ The course is divided into several units, each focusing on a specific aspect of language and composition․

Understanding the Course

The AP Language and Composition course is designed to help students develop their critical thinking and writing skills, with a focus on analyzing and interpreting literary and nonfiction texts․ Through a combination of lectures, discussions, and writing assignments, students will learn to identify and explain the author’s purpose, tone, and use of rhetorical devices․ The course will also cover the principles of composition, including organization, style, and grammar․ By the end of the course, students will be able to write effective arguments, analyze complex texts, and demonstrate a deep understanding of the subject matter․ The course is divided into units, each focusing on a specific aspect of language and composition, such as syntax, diction, and figurative language․ Students will have the opportunity to practice their skills through regular writing assignments and quizzes, and will receive feedback from their instructor to help them improve․ Overall, the course is designed to prepare students for the AP exam and for future academic and professional writing endeavors․
